Pilbara Ecological conducts revegetation monitoring to assess and measure the progress of revegetation against completion criteria.

This ensures any issues are identified early and allows for an adaptive management approach. Early identification of risks means future costly remediation measures are avoided.

Pilbara Ecological can design a revegetation monitoring program in line with the objectives of the project and relevant legislative or regulatory requirements.

We develop revegetation monitoring plans which are consistent with the SMART principles: spec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ound. Our staff have previously conducted revegetation monitoring works within the non-profit, government and mining sectors.

Mine site vegetation management

Our team has experience managing and implementing long term spraying programs on mine site, rail and port infrastructure across the Pilbara. Being a local business, we can also mobilise at low cost for small jobs where required.

We use a range of weed control techniques to best manage weeds and vegetation around mine site infrastructure, focusing on maintaining operational areas and minimising fire risks. Our staff are experienced in managing the unique hazards present in mining environments.
